Micro-BTS References 6.1 Rack Configuration 6.1.1 MBTR I (1.9GHz) 6.1.2 MBTR I (800MHz) 6.2 DIP Switch and Strap 6.2.1 Summary 6.2.2 Purpose 6.2.3 Address Setting in Common 6.2.4 BMPA-B2 6.2.5 CDCA-B1 6.2.6 BICA-B1 6.2.7 HLTA-B1 6.3 LED Descriptions 6.3.1 BMP 6.3.2 DU 6.3.3 TFU 6.3.4 RPU 6.4 Alarm Source List 6.5 Abbreviations User’s Manual PROPRIETARY & CONFIDENTIAL 1-1 Chapter 1 System Overview 1.1 Purpose of this document This chapter contains description of Hyundai Micro-BTS PCS System that is operating on 800MHz and 1.9GHz frequency band, repectively. 1.2 Features of Hyundai CDMA System There are two sub-systems in Hyundai CDMA system ; Micro-BTS and BSC. BSC interfaces with switching equipment and has roles of vocoding and call processing. Micro- BTS is functionally located between MS (Mobile Station) and BSC. Hyundai Micro-BTS has channel resource unit and radio frequency RF unit similar to the conventional 3-Sector BTS. Contrary to conventional 3-Sector BTS, Hyundai Micro-BTS is small in size, easily can be installed and maintained, and is very cheap in cost. 1.3 Overview Hyundai Micro-BTS system can support 2FA/3Sector using 2 racks, but Micro-BTS system is composed of 1FA/3sector system for the FCC authorization. Thus this manual will describe all of the specifications based on 1FA/3sector system. The system configuration is shown in Figure 1.1. In this configuration, there are 1 BSC and 3 Micro-BTS systems. Each Micro-BTS system is separately located in 3 sites. Micro-BTS can use 2 types of antenna subsystem, RRU (Remote RF Unit) and AAU (Active Antenna Unit). RRU is connected to Micro-BTS main system through AIU (Antenna Interface Unit) and AAU through AIDU (Active Internal Distribution Unit). In case of trunk line, we have several solutions, T1 and E1. We use T1 trunk line in USA. It means that we do not use HLEA but HLTA as trunk card. BSM manages and maintains Micro-BTS and BSC. It communicates with each system by transmitting and receiving packets through LCIN. Its features include performance management, configuration management, fault management, etc.. System Quality Assurance Office • FCC ID:CKLHD-MIC1900A • Trade Name(s):HYUNDAI • Model(s):HD-MIC 1900 • Quantity:Quantity production is planned • Emission Designator:1M25F9W • Maximum Power Rating:8.0 W (+39 dBm) • FCC Classification:Licensed Base Station for Part 24 (PCB) • Equipment (EUT) Type:Base Station Transceiver Subsystem • Frequency Block(s):Blocks C, E & F • Channel(s):725 - 1175 • Modulation:CDMA • FCC Rule Part(s):§24(E), §2 • Application Type:Certification • Tx Frequency Range: 1966.25 – 1988.75 MHz • Rx Frequency Range:1886.25 – 1908.75 MHz • Frequency Tolerance:± 0.05 ppm • Dates of Tests:November 29 - December 03, 1999 • Place of Tests:PCTEST Lab, Columbia, MD U.S.A. 991129632.CKL Test Report S/N: 24.991129632.CKLFCC Part 24 Dates of Tests: Nov. 29 – Dec. 03, 1999Certification © 1999 PCTEST LabFCC ID: CKLHD-MIC1900A (Licensed Base Station)2 HYUNDAI PCS CDMA Base Station Transceiver Subsystem 2.1 INTRODUCTION These measurement tests were conducted at PCTEST Engineering Laboratory, Inc. facility in New Concept Business Park, Guilford Industrial Park, Columbia, Maryland. The site address is 6660-B Dobbin Road, Columbia, MD 21045. The test site is one of the highest points in the Columbia area with an elevation of 390 feet above mean sea level. The site coordinates are 39° 11'15" N latitude and 76° 49'38" W longitude. The facility is 1.5 miles North of the FCC laboratory, and the ambient signal and ambient signal strength are approximately equal to those of the FCC laboratory. There are no FM or TV transmitters within 15 miles of the site. The detailed description of the measurement facility was found to be in compliance with the requirements of § 2.948 according to ANSI C63.4 on October 19, 1992. PCTEST Lab is recognized under the National Voluntary Laboratory Accreditation Program for satisfactory compliance with criteria established in Title 15, Part 285 Code of Federal Regulations. These criteria encompass the requirements of ISO/IEC Guide 25 and the relevant requirements of ISO 9002 (ANSI/ASQC Q92-1987) as suppliers of calibration or test results.
